读前警告:本文MD以及\(\LaTeX\)差到爆炸,因为是直接复制的。首先,\(\varphi(n)\)的值是\(n\)内与\(n\)互质的数的个数。//求n的欧拉函数值:phi[n]intgetPhi(intn){intans=n;for(inti=2;i*i1)ans=ans*(n-1)/n;returnans;}时间复杂度:sqrt(n)你可能会问:你这玩意除了装X还有个【数据删除】用?欸嘿还真不是,来了题你就知道了T1给定整数N和M,有多少整数X满足1=M?第一行输入是一个整数T(T首先\(N\)最多有\(\sqrtn\)个因数(说实话大多数时间达不到这个上限)设\(d\)是\(N\)
整理&撰稿| 言征、伊风出品|51CTO技术栈(微信号:blog51cto)一年一度,世界移动通信大会终于又来了!身处GenAI之年,全球各大巨头汇聚在此,纷纷秀出了怎样的肌肉,不知道各位看官如何看待下面这五款产品,反正小编是“哇塞”了一个上午,款款都想剁手。1.联想推出透明笔记本:全透明屏幕,无实体键盘早在2月9日,就有外媒传出消息联想透明屏笔记本将出现在MWC2024上。展台现场吸引了不少国际友人的驻足。联想展示了其首款透明屏概念笔记本ThinkBookTransparentDisplayLaptop,据称也是全球首款透明笔记本电脑。ThinkBookTransparentDisplayL
文章目录软件下载介绍STC89C52RC命名规则芯片介绍开发板介绍逻辑运算C语言语法函数在C语言基础上做的拓展重入函数中断函数外部函数sfrsbit51单片机最小系统组成程序编写前言程序框架头文件作用程序烧录HELLOWORLD——LED部分点亮LEDLED闪烁Keil软件仿真LED流水灯移位函数蜂鸣器实验简谱使用蜂鸣器数码管按键矩阵按键IO扩展(串转并)-74HC595点亮LED点阵LED点阵实验步进电机中断定时器中断实验外部中断实验通信通信基础知识串口封装头文件;绘制LED动画IIC,AT24C02EEPROMI2CI2C结构I2C协议AT24C02创建多文件工程温度传感器DS18B20i
蜂鸟E203总体框架蜂鸟E203处理器系统如下图所示一、蜂鸟E203处理器核设计总览和顶层1.1蜂鸟E203处理器核的设计理念模块化和可重用性:将处理器分成几个主体模块,每个单元之间的接口简单清晰。面积最小化:追求低功耗和小面积,尽可能地服用数据通路以节省面积开销结构简单化性能不追求极端1.2蜂鸟E203处理器核的RTL代码风格使用标准的DFF模块例化、生成寄存器推荐使用Verilog中的assign语法替代if-else和case语法1.2.1使用标准的DFF模块例化生成寄存器wireflg_rwireflg_nxt=~flp_r;wireflg_enasirv_gnrl_dfflr#(1)
PCIE引起的系统无法启动完成1.外部晶振芯片的时钟输入是否异常,如果无时钟或者幅度异常,将导致phy无法锁定。2.检查PCIE供电电压 PCIE30_AVDD_0V9和PCIE30_AVDD_1V8电压是否满足要求。PCIE不使用时,必须屏蔽,否则启动卡在PCIE3*2附近不远处&pcie30phy{status="disabled";};&pcie3x2{status="disabled";};Linux中输入设备的事件类型有EV_SYN0x00同步事件EV_KEY0x01按键事件,如KEY_VOLUMEDOWNEV_REL0x02相对坐标, 如鼠标上报的坐标EV_ABS0x03绝对坐标,
自增自减运算符短路逻辑运算符两只老虎,用三元运算符比较大小publicclassHelloWorld{publicstaticvoidmain(String[] args) { intm=180; intn=200; booleanb=m==n?true:false; System.out.println("b:"+b);}}三个和尚publicclassHelloWorld{publicstaticvoidmain(String[] args) { inta=150; intb=165; intc=210; intzhonghight=a>b?a:b; intmax=zhonghight>c
文章目录七、回溯算法八、贪心算法九、动态规划9.1背包问题9.201背包9.3完全背包9.4多重背包十、图论10.1深度优先搜索10.2广度优先搜索10.3并查集 最近博主学习了算法与数据结构的一些视频,在这个文章做一些笔记和心得,本篇文章就写了一些基础算法和数据结构的知识点,具体题目解析会放在另外一篇文章。在学习时已经有C,C++的基础。文章附上了学习的代码,仅供大家参考。如果有问题,有错误欢迎大家留言。算法与数据结构一共有三篇文章,剩余文章可以在【CSDN文章】晚安66博客文章索引找到。七、回溯算法 回溯算法也可以叫回溯搜索法,它是一种搜索的方式。回溯是递归的副产品,有递归就有回溯,因
1. 技术世界1.1. 为了创造一个更加公正的技术世界,我们在创造技术的时候,需要接受更多不同的声音1.2. 在计算机科学中,很难说清楚‘简单’和‘几乎不可能’的区别1.3. 谈论计算太难了,这导致了很多误解1.3.1. 计算机在某些方面表现得非常优秀,而在另外一些方面表现得非常糟糕1.3.2. 当人们误判计算机在执行任务时的参与程度时,社会问题就会产生1.4. 蹒跚学步的孩子一般可以在不踩到玩具的情况下在房间内行走(当然,她可能会偏不这样干),但机器人做不到1.5. 使用机器人
和你一起终身学习,这里是程序员Android经典好文推荐,通过阅读本文,您将收获以下知识点:一、Camera框架介绍:Camera的框架分为Kernel部分和hal部分,其中kernel部分主要有两块:imagesensordriver,负责具体型号的sensor的id检测,上电,以及在preview、capture、初始化、3A等等功能设定时的寄存器配置;ispdriver,通过DMA将sensor数据流上传;HAL层部分主要有三部分组成:imageio,主要负责数据buffer上传的pipe;drv,包含imgsensor和isp的hal层控制;featureio,包含各种3A等性能配置;
目录前言1、FPGA是什么?2、FPGA开发环境2.1 语言环境2.2FPGA开发思路总结前言在专用集成电路(ASIC)领域中,FPGA作为一种半定制电路而出现的,既解决了定制电路的不足,又克服了原有可编程器件门电路数有限的缺点。同时FPGA可用于实现硬件灵活定制,能够高效地实现算法加速、数据处理,从而提高系统的性能。1、FPGA是什么?FPGA(全称:FieldProgrammableGateArray),即现场可编程门阵列,它是在PAL、GAL、CPLD等可编程器件的基础上进一步发展的产物。FPGA是一种完成通用功能的可编程逻辑芯片,即可以对其进行编程实现某种逻辑处理功能。FPGA更偏向